Installing and activating your eSIM before departure
After purchase, the QR code arrives by email within minutes. Scan it from your device settings before you leave home, while you still have Wi-Fi. The eSIM profile installs immediately, but the plan does not start counting down until you land in Åland and turn on data roaming for the new profile.
Most phones released after 2019 support eSIM, including recent iPhones, Google Pixels, and Samsung Galaxy models. Check your device compatibility before buying. Once installed, you can toggle between your home SIM and the eSIM without removing anything physical, then delete the Åland profile when your trip ends.
Staying online across the archipelago
Mariehamn, the capital on Fasta Åland, has consistent mobile coverage in the town center, harbor, and main commercial streets. Inter-island ferries operated by the regional government usually maintain connectivity during shorter crossings between the larger populated islands, though signal may drop briefly in open water or approaching smaller skerries.
If you rent a bike or drive the archipelago route through Vårdö, Lumparland, or out to Kökar, expect coverage in villages and along main roads, but prepare for gaps in forested interior stretches and on the smallest outer islands. Offline maps are recommended for rural cycling. A 500MB plan handles essential navigation and messaging for a day trip to Mariehamn; multi-day island exploration with photo uploads will require a larger bundle.
Frequently asked questions
Do these eSIMs work on all the Åland Islands?
Coverage is available on the main inhabited islands where mobile infrastructure exists. You will have connectivity in Mariehamn and larger villages, but signal may be limited or absent in remote areas, forested interiors, and on the smallest outer islands.
Can I make phone calls with an Åland eSIM?
No. All plans are data-only. You will not receive a local number and cannot make traditional voice calls or send SMS. You can use internet-based calling through WhatsApp, Telegram, or similar apps over your data connection.
When does my plan validity start counting down?
The countdown begins when you arrive in Åland and enable data roaming on the eSIM profile. You can install the QR code before departure, and it will remain inactive until you turn on mobile data in the destination.
Which devices work with these eSIM plans?
Most smartphones released after 2019 support eSIM, including iPhone XR and later, Google Pixel 3 and later, and Samsung Galaxy S20 and newer. Check your device specifications or contact your manufacturer if unsure before purchasing.
How much data do I need for a visit to Åland?
A 500MB plan covers basic navigation and messaging for a day trip. If you are island-hopping for several days, uploading photos, or streaming content, choose a larger bundle. Downloading offline maps before arrival helps conserve data in rural areas.
